Understanding the Nissan GT-R R35 Engine
The heart of the Nissan GT-R R35 is its VR38DETT engine, an engineering marvel that combines performance with reliability. This engine has evolved since its introduction, offering various power outputs and modifications.
Key Features of the VR38DETT Engine
- Configuration: V6, 60-degree
- Displacement: 3.8L (3,799 cc)
- Power Output: Ranges from 480 hp to 570 hp in stock form, with modified versions exceeding 2000 hp.
- Turbocharging: Twin-turbocharged for boosted performance.
- Fuel System: Direct fuel injection for efficiency and power.
Performance and Tuning Potential
The VR38DETT is renowned for its tuning potential. Many enthusiasts opt to modify the engine to achieve higher horsepower, making it suitable for various applications, from street racing to track events. Professional tuners can enhance performance through upgraded turbos, exhaust systems, and ECU remapping.

What is the Nissan GT-R R35 motor?
The Nissan GT-R R35 motor, known as the VR38DETT, is a 3.8-liter twin-turbocharged V6 engine that powers the Nissan GT-R model from 2007 to 2020.
How much horsepower does the VR38DETT engine produce?
The stock VR38DETT engine produces between 480 to 570 horsepower, depending on the model year and specifications.
